Small Quirks or Limitations
While the Alone Font is an amazing addition to any design library, there are a few things to keep in mind: ⚠️
- 🤔 Legibility at small sizes: Like many script fonts, the Alone Font can be tricky to read at very small sizes. Be sure to test it out at different sizes to ensure it’s legible for your project.
- ⚠️ Overuse of swashes: While the swashes and flourishes are a beautiful part of the Alone Font, overusing them can make your design look cluttered. Balance is key!
A Practical Guide: Using the Alone Font in Your Designs
Canva
Using the Alone Font in Canva is easy! Here’s how:
- Upload the Alone Font to Canva by going to Uploads > Add files and selecting the font file.
- Select the text element you want to edit and choose the Alone Font from the font dropdown menu.
- To access OpenType features like swashes and stylistic alternates, click on the Text > Advanced dropdown menu and select OpenType.
Adobe Photoshop/Illustrator
Using the Alone Font in Adobe Creative Cloud apps is a breeze:
- Install the Alone Font on your computer by following the installation instructions for your operating system.
- Open Photoshop or Illustrator and select the text tool.
- Choose the Alone Font from the font dropdown menu and access OpenType features by going to Window > Typography.
Microsoft Word
Yes, you can even use the Alone Font in Microsoft Word! Here’s how:
- Install the Alone Font on your computer.
- Open Word and select the text you want to edit.
- Choose the Alone Font from the font dropdown menu and access OpenType features by going to Home > Font > OpenType.
